Understanding Shaheed Diwas: FAQs
To truly appreciate Shaheed Diwas, it's important to understand the context and answer some common questions surrounding this significant day.
What is Shaheed Diwas?
Shaheed Diwas, also known as Martyrs' Day, is observed to commemorate the sacrifices of martyrs for the nation. It's a day to pay tribute to those who gave up their lives for India's independence, peace, and progress.
Why is Shaheed Diwas Celebrated?
Shaheed Diwas is celebrated to remember and honor the courage and sacrifices of Indian martyrs. It serves as a reminder of the price of freedom and inspires us to uphold the values they stood for. It's a day to instill patriotism and remember the debt we owe to these heroes.
Who are considered Martyrs in the context of Shaheed Diwas?
In the context of Shaheed Diwas, martyrs are primarily individuals who sacrificed their lives during India's freedom struggle and in defense of the nation post-independence. This includes freedom fighters, soldiers, and others who died for the country's cause.
When is Shaheed Diwas Celebrated?
While several days are observed as Shaheed Diwas in India, the most prominent is observed on March 23rd. This day specifically commemorates the martyrdom of Bhagat Singh, Sukhdev Thapar, and Shivaram Rajguru, who were hanged by the British government in 1931. Another Shaheed Diwas is observed on January 30th, the death anniversary of Mahatma Gandhi.

Inspiring Patriotism Quotes for Shaheed Diwas
Patriotism is a profound emotion, and the words of those who lived and breathed it can deeply move and inspire us. Here are some powerful patriotism quotes to reflect upon this Shaheed Diwas:
Quotes on Sacrifice and Courage
- "Patriotism is not about waving a flag. Patriotism is about striving to make your nation more worthy of waving that flag." - Unknown
- "The spirit of nationalism is stronger than any weapon of mass destruction." - Unknown
- "The greatest gift you can give to your country is your life. The greatest sacrifice is to lay it down for your nation." - Unknown
- "Let new India arise out of peasants' cottage, grasping the plough, out of huts, cobbler and sweeper." - Swami Vivekananda
- "Ask not what your country can do for you, ask what you can do for your country." - John F. Kennedy (Universal, but resonates with the spirit of duty)
- "Our flag does not fly because the wind moves it, it flies with the last breath of each soldier who died protecting it." - Unknown
- "Freedom is never dear at any price. It is the breath of life. What would a man not pay for living?" - Mahatma Gandhi
- "If yet your blood does not rage, then it is water that flows in your veins. For what is the flush of youth, if it is not of service to the motherland." - Chandra Shekhar Azad
- "Bombs and pistols do not make revolution. The sword of revolution is sharpened on the whetting-stone of ideas." - Bhagat Singh
- "They may torture my body, break my bones, even kill me. Then they will have my dead body, but not my obedience." - Mahatma Gandhi
Quotes on Freedom and Nation
- "Swaraj is my birthright and I shall have it!" - Bal Gangadhar Tilak
- "Long years ago we made a tryst with destiny, and now the time comes when we shall redeem our pledge, not wholly or in full measure, but very substantially. At the stroke of the midnight hour, when the world sleeps, India will awake to life and freedom." - Jawaharlal Nehru
- "Give me blood, and I shall give you freedom!" -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ose
- "So long as you do not achieve social liberty, whatever freedom is provided by the law is of no avail to you." - B. R. Ambedkar
- "A country's greatness lies in its undying ideals of love and sacrifice that inspire the mothers of the race." - Sarojini Naidu
- "Even if I die in the service of the nation, I would be proud of it. Every drop of my blood… will contribute to the growth of this nation and to make it strong and dynamic." - Indira Gandhi
- "Our nation is like a tree of which the original trunk is swarajya and the branches are swadeshi and boycott." - Subhas Chandra Bose
- "Forget not that the grossest crime is to compromise with injustice and wrong. Remember the eternal law: you must give if you desire to get." -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ose
- "This is our Motherland and it is our duty to make it our paradise." - Veer Savarkar
- "May the sun in his course visit no land more free, more happy, more lovely, than this our own country!" - Sardar Bhagat Singh
